#WorldDiabetesDay: Be mindful of what you eat, drink – Dr Adeyanju

Published by

AS the world marks World Diabetes Day, the Ondo State Commissioner for Health, Dr Dayo Adeyanju, has called on all and sundry to be mindful of what they eat and drink as this will go a long way in keeping diabetes at bay.

Dr Adeyanju made the call today while commissioning the Diabetes Association of Nigeria building at the state’s Specialist Complex, Akure.

According to him, millions of Nigerians are believed to be living with diabetes, saying that the way to prevent and control it is by adhering to doctor’s instructions at all times.

Dr Adeyanju, who reiterated the determination of the present government to provide qualitative healthcare, charged diabetes’ patients to always make themselves available for treatments in the health facilities across the state.

Explaining that health is wealth, Dr Adeyanju stressed the need for regular check-up, noting that such would go a long way in helping to know one’s health status.

Earlier, the chairman, Diabetes Association of Nigeria, Professor Sola Falaki, explained that the main objective of the association is to fish out most of the diagnosed diabetes cases in order to prevent complication of the disease, such as stroke, limb amputation, heart attack, kidney failure and eye problems.

He later, expressed appreciation to the government of Ondo State for providing the association with a building and diabetes diagnostic Centre at the State’s Specialist Hospital, Akure.
